What is CNC Milling?
CNC stands for Computer Numerical Control. CNC milling machines allow metal cutters to be precisely directed by programmed instructions that define variable shapes and forms. This automation reduces manual labor and human error, providing opportunities for manufacturers to focus on innovation and quality rather than repetitive setup tasks.

Benefits of CNC Milling Services
- Unparalleled Precision: CNC milling offers the highest levels of accuracy and surface finish quality. This is crucial in industries like aerospace, medical equipment, and automotive manufacturing, where even minor deviations can have serious consequences.
- Increased Efficiency: Highly automated CNC milling reduces the need for human intervention, shortening production times and lowering labor costs, while meeting tight deadlines with ease.
- Consistent Quality and Reliability: CNC milling maintains uniform quality across all produced parts, minimizing defects and reducing the need for rework or scrap, which is vital for customer satisfaction.
- Material Versatility: CNC milling can handle a broad range of materials including metals, plastics, and composites, making it suitable for diverse applications across many industries.
- Capability for Complex Geometries: CNC milling machines can precisely create intricate contours and complex shapes, enabling innovative product designs and better performance.
Applications of CNC Milling Parts
The versatility of CNC milling allows its use across several key industries:
- Aerospace: Manufacturing precise engine parts, landing gear components, and structural elements requiring the utmost accuracy and reliability.
- Automotive: Creating complex engine components, transmission parts, and critical vehicle elements designed for performance and durability.
- Medical: Producing surgical instruments, implants, and medical devices where precision and sterility are paramount.
- Electronics: Fabricating circuit boards, connectors, and semiconductors that demand exacting tolerances for optimal function.
